X-Ray Technician Job Description in Tollhouse CA

Tollhouse CA radiologic technologist examining x-rayThere are several professional designations for x-ray techs (technologists or technicians). They can also be referred to as radiologic technologists, radiologic technicians, radiographers or radiology techs. Regardless of the name, each has the identical fundamental job function, which is to employ imaging machines to internally visualize patients for the objective of diagnosis and treatment. A number of radiologic technologists may also administer radiation therapy for treating cancer. Many opt to perform as generalists, while others may choose a specialty, for example mammography. They may practice in Tollhouse CA hospitals, clinics, private practices or outpatient diagnostic imaging centers. The imaging technologies that an X-Ray tech might work with include:

  • Traditional and specialized X-Rays
  • Computerized tomography (CT) or “CAT” scans
  •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I)
  • Sonography or ultrasound
  • Fluoroscopy

Radiographers must maintain their equipment plus routinely assess its functionality and safety. They are also required to keep complete records of each of their diagnostic procedures. As medical practitioners, they must adhere to a code of conduct and a high professional standard.

Radiology Tech Degrees near Tollhouse CA

Tollhouse CA x-ray tech school internship programThe basic requirement for attending an x-ray tech college is to have earned a high school diploma or GED. Radiologic technologist students have the option to earn either an Associate or a Bachelor’s Degree. An Associate Degree, which is the most common among techs, generally requires 18 months to two years to finish based upon the program and course load. A Bachelor’s Degree will take more time at as much as four years to finish and is more expansive in nature. Most students opt for a degree major in Radiography, but there are additional related majors that are appropriate as well. One thing to consider is that radiographer colleges have a practical training or lab component as a component of their curriculum. It can often be satisfied by participating in an externship program which many colleges sponsor through local hospitals and clinics in Tollhouse CA or their area. After you have graduated from one of the degree programs, you must comply with any licensing or certification requirements in California or the state you will be working as applicable.

Radiologic Technologist Certification and Licensing

When you have graduated from an X-Ray tech school, based on the state where you will be working you may have to become licensed. The majority of states do require licensing, and their prerequisites differ so contact your state. Presently, all states that do require licensure will recognize The American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ification exam for the purpose of licensing, but several provide other options for testing as well. A number of states also require certification as a component of the licensing process, if not it is optional. Having said that, numerous Tollhouse area employers would rather hire radiology techs that are certified so it may improve your career options in and around Tollhouse CA to earn certification. ARRT’s certification program involves graduation from an accepted program as well as a passing score on their comprehensive examination. ARRT also calls for re-certification every other year, which may be satisfied with 24 credits of continuing ed, or by passing an exam.

Are the X-Ray Tech Schools Accredited? A large number of radiology tech schools have obtained some type of accreditation, whether national or regional. Nevertheless, it’s still important to confirm that the school and program are accredited. One of the most highly respected accrediting agencies in the field of radiology is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Radiologic Technology (JRCERT). Schools receiving accreditation from the JRCERT have gone through a detailed examination of their instructors and course materials. If the school is online it might also receive acc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which targets distance or online education. All accrediting agencies should be acknowledged by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Along with ensuring a quality education, accreditation will also assist in acquiring financial aid and student loans, which are often not offered for non-accredited programs. Accreditation can also be a pre-requisite for licensing and certification as required. And numerous Tollhouse CA employers will only hire a graduate of an accredited school for entry level positions.

    Tollhouse, California

    Tollhouse (formerly, Toll House) is an unincorporated community in Fresno County, California.[1] It lies at an elevation of 1,919 feet (585 m).[1] Tollhouse is located in the Sierra Nevada, 7 miles (11 km) southwest of Shaver Lake.[2] It is home to 2,089 people[3].

    The town was created in the 1860s around a lumber mill. The name "tollhouse" comes from the fact that the community was also built up in connection to a now-defunct toll road running up the steep slopes of Sarver Peak to Pineridge and housed a toll house.
